1. Cut bacon into 1-inch pieces cook in medium saucepan over medium-high heat 3 to 4 minutes or until almost cooked. Add onion cook 3 to 5 minutes or until bacon is crisp and onion is tender, stirring occasionally.
2. Combine ketchup, apple juice, vinegar,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per add to bacon mixture. Reduce heat cover and simmer until flavors are blended, 15 to 20 minutes.
3. Stir in Equal and sliced beef. Serve warm on rolls, if desired.
MICROWAVE DIRECTIONS:
Cut bacon into 1-inch pieces and place in 1 1/2-qt microwavable casserole. Cook, uncovered, at HIGH 1 minute. Add onion and cook at HIGH for 2 1/2 to 3 minutes or until bacon is crisp and onion is tender, stirring once. Combine ketchup, apple juice, vinegar,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per add to bacon mixture. Cook, covered, at HIGH 4 to 5 minutes or until boiling. Cook at MEDIUM 8 to 10 minutes or until flavors are blended, stirring twice. Stir in Equal and sliced beef. Serve warm.
